Q. How did BRGS report its news, achievements, pictures, and messages before
we had our own website?
A. Through school magazines of course!
Teams of teachers and pupils would get together annually to produce a magazine
of entertaining articles and illustrations for the year, but also report news
and the school's achievements.
You may have heard of The Squirrel, but before it was The Squirrel, it
was named The Journal.
